What is Ombre Furniture?
Ombre, meaning "shaded" or "shadowed" in French, describes a gradual blending of colors. In furniture, this translates to pieces featuring a smooth transition between two or more shades of the same color, or even subtly contrasting hues. This effect can be achieved through various techniques, including paint, fabric dyeing, or even the strategic arrangement of materials. The result is a piece that's visually captivating and adds a touch of modern elegance to any room.
Different Types of Ombre Furniture
Ombre isn't limited to a single style or material. You can find ombre effects on a wide range of furniture pieces:
- Ombre painted furniture: This is a popular choice, often seen on wooden furniture where layers of paint create a soft gradient effect. Think a nightstand transitioning from a pale cream to a deep navy.
- Ombre upholstered furniture: Sofas, armchairs, and ottomans can feature ombre fabrics, with the color subtly changing across the surface. This method creates a softer, more luxurious look.
- Ombre stained furniture: This technique is often used on wooden pieces, applying varying shades of stain to achieve a gradual color shift. This provides a more natural and rustic ombre effect.
How to Incorporate Ombre Furniture into Your Home
The key to successfully integrating ombre furniture into your home is balance and harmony. Avoid overwhelming a space by using ombre in moderation. Consider these tips:
1. Choose the Right Color Palette
The color palette you select will heavily influence the overall feel of your space. Cool-toned ombre furniture, such as blues and greens, can create a calming and serene atmosphere. Warm-toned ombre furniture, like oranges and browns, can add warmth and coziness. Consider the existing color scheme of your room and choose an ombre piece that complements it, rather than clashes.
2. Find the Perfect Piece
Don't feel pressured to revamp your entire home with ombre furniture. Start small! A single ombre accent chair, a side table, or even a set of ombre throw pillows can make a significant impact. Focus on a statement piece that will draw the eye and add visual interest without being overpowering.
3. Consider the Scale and Placement
The size and placement of your ombre furniture are crucial. A large ombre sofa in a small room might feel overwhelming, while a smaller ombre side table can get lost in a large space. Strategically place your ombre furniture to maximize its visual impact and maintain a balanced aesthetic.
4. Balance with Solid Colors and Textures
To prevent your room from looking too busy, balance your ombre furniture with pieces in solid colors and various textures. This will create visual harmony and prevent the ombre effect from feeling too dominant.
